The Hydrofoil is an Allied fast and lightweight anti-aircraft and support boat used during the Third World War and the Uprising.

Background[]

Main article: Hydrofoil/Profile

Adapted from a light skiff commonly employed by the Coast Guard of South American Allied nations, the hydrofoil is a fast-moving vessel designed for surveillance and defensive operations. It features a fast-firing 20 mm CIWS well-suited for engaging low-flying enemy aircraft, although its facing limits the weapon to a pure anti-air role. The hydrofoil gains versatility thanks to its Scramblegun weapon jammer, an electromagnetic beam that draws upon the hydrofoil's advanced computers and fuel reserves to temporarily disable most known weapons systems on an individual, nearby target.

Today's hydrofoil was made famous in the Battle of Port-Au-Prince, in which a small fleet of them were able to shoot down an entire squadron of MiG fighters before the MiGs could eliminate a wing of Century bombers carrying reinforcements to the city. Meanwhile, several of the hydrofoils broke off to thwart an offshore dreadnought bombardment. After the MiGs were destroyed, the hydrofoils executed a high-speed tactical retreat. The only naval casualties that day were hydrofoil detachments that were unlucky enough to be sucked from out of the water by the Soviets' hated magnetic satellite. It has been rumored that the performance of the hyrdofoil that day was largely responsible for increased numbers of Soviet Akula-class submarines in Soviet operations around the Gulf of Mexico.

Hydrofoil captains are more often than not former Coast Guard defenders looking to do the Allied nations proud, and they tend to be regarded for their poise in the face of formidable enemy fleets.

Game unit[]

Hydrofoils are the Allies only naval unit that hit air. Their weapon jammers can jam the weapons of a single ship, vehicle or aircraft making them vulnerable to counterattacks. Hydrofoils make fine escorts to assault destroyers and aircraft carriers. Hydrofoils cannot damage ground or naval units especially Yaris and Stingrays.

Abilities[]

RA3 AA Gun Icons
AA Gun The main weapon for the Hydrofoil, the Chain Gun is capable of tearing any enemy air unit to shreds in seconds, no matter their armor. The weapon cannot be targeted at ground units, however, leaving the Hydrofoil vulnerable to any form of ground or sea attack.
RA3 Weapon Jammer Icons
Weapons Jammer By alternating its weapon systems, the Hydrofoil can use a jammer that is capable of preventing any unit or defensive structure from using their weapons and weapon-related special abilities, rendering them useless.

Trivia[]

  • The Hydrofoils' captains appear to be speak in a Jamaican accent.
  • Hydrofoils rise from the water when on the move, supported only by their "fins". After moving, they will slowly sink again to its original position.
  • Rarely, when the Hydrofoil is ordered to switch weapons, a glitch will occur. A Hydrofoil will fire using its Scramblegun or jam enemies by focusing them with the chain gun, with the effects still included.
  • Judging from the red markings and white finish of the boats' concept artwork below, it can be assumed that the ship was originally designed for the Empire of the Rising Sun.
